私钥是一个由数字和字母组成的字符串,用于生成对应的公钥,并签名交易。在不同的加密钱包中,私钥的格式和长度可能有所不同。一般情况下,Imtoken钱包的私钥采用的是一种名为“以太坊钱包私钥”的形式,这通常是64个十六进制数字,即256位。这样的设计确保了私钥的随机性和复杂性,从而提高了资产的安全性。
隐私性和安全性是区块链技术的一项核心优势,私钥是保证用户资产完全安全的关键。如果私钥泄露,任何知晓私钥的人都可以访问进行交易,甚至可以完全控制用户的加密资产。所以,用户在管理私钥的时候,必须非常谨慎。
#### 私钥的结构与长度私钥在大多数情况下是一个256位的数字,通常以64位的十六进制字符串表示。对以太坊及其相关钱包(包括Imtoken钱包)来说,私钥是从一个随机生成的数值中派生出来的。这种方式确保了每个生成的私钥都是唯一的,不容易被猜测。
一般而言,Imtoken钱包的私钥格式为:0x 64位十六进制数,这使其长度达到是66位。这样的设计确保了即使是最先进的计算机技术也很难进行暴力破解。
#### 管理私钥的最佳实践管理私钥时,用户应遵循一些最佳实践,来降低资产被盗或丢失的风险:
1. **不会与他人分享私钥**:私钥就像是你银行账户的密码,任何人一旦获得,便应能随意操作你的账户。因此在任何情况下都不要分享私钥。 2. **定期备份私钥**:确保将私钥保存在安全地方并进行定期备份,这样即便设备故障也能恢复资产。 3. **使用冷钱包**:将大量资产存储在冷钱包(离线钱包)中,可以有效减少被黑客攻击的风险。 4. **启用双重认证**:一些钱包提供了双重认证的选项,增加了一个额外的安全层,即便是黑客也难以轻易访问你的账户。 5. **保持软件更新**:确保使用最新版本的钱包应用,这样可以获得最新的安全更新和漏洞修复。 #### 私钥丢失会带来什么后果?私钥是对你加密资产的唯一访问方式,如果丢失了私钥,你将永远失去对钱包内所有资产的控制权。这一情况在区块链世界中是非常严重的,因为区块链的去中心化特性使得没有任何机构可以恢复丢失的私钥或资产。因此,在使用加密货币时,务必妥善管理和备份私钥。
如果用户丢失了私钥,唯一能够做的事情就是承认损失。无论是以太币还是任何其他数字资产,一旦私钥丢失,就没有第三方可以帮助到你。很多情况下,由于市场的不可预测性,丢失的资产可能会在未来增值,造成更大的经济损失。
为了避免这一情况,用户在创建钱包时,应选择一款界面友好的钱包软件,并定期检查和备份私钥,确保资金的安全。
#### 如何安全存储私钥?
为了保障私钥的安全性,用户需要采取一系列措施,以确保私钥不易被泄露或丢失。以下是一些推荐的私钥存储方式:
1. **加密保存**:将私钥进行加密后再进行保存,可以大大增加私钥被盗用的难度。使用强密码进行加密,并确保密码本身也要保管好。 2. **使用冷钱包**:如前所述,冷钱包是将私钥存储在不连接互联网的设备上的一种方法,这有效防止了在线黑客攻击。 3. **纸质备份**:可以将私钥打印出来或写在纸质文件上,这样即使设备故障,仍然能够通过纸质备份恢复私钥。务必将纸质备份存放在安全的地方,防止火灾、水灾等。 4. **硬件钱包**:使用硬件钱包(如Ledger或Trezor)存储私钥,这类设备设计专为保护私钥而生,安全性远高于软件钱包。 5. **使用多重签名**:在进行大额交易时,可以考虑采用多重签名技术,这种方式要求多个私钥签名才能完成交易,提高资金安全性。 #### 是不是越复杂的私钥就越安全?私钥的复杂性在一定程度上影响着安全性。长度更长且随机性更高的私钥,破解的难度会更大。但仅仅依赖私钥的复杂性是不够的,还需要综合考虑以下因素:
1. **随机性**:私钥的生成需要高质量的随机数。如果生成的私钥基于可预测的随机数,则即使它的长度很长,安全性也会大幅降低。 2. **使用可靠的生成工具**:应使用公认的、经过验证的钱包软件来生成私钥,这可以有效减少弱随机数算法导致的安全性问题。 3. **提高密码保护**:即便私钥本身具有足够的复杂度,如果没有进行进一步的加密和保护,例如密码保护或双重认证,其安全性仍可受到威胁。 4. **考虑社会工程学**:即使私钥的复杂性很高,如果用户没有注意到社会工程学攻击(例如钓鱼或伪装攻击),也会导致被盗。因此,用户的防范意识同样重要。 #### 如何恢复丢失的私钥?
如果用户不幸丢失了私钥,由于区块链的去中心化特性,恢复已丢失的私钥几乎是不可能的。然而,有一些方法可以试图最大限度地减少损失:
1. **从助记词恢复**:一些钱包在创建时会生成助记词,如果用户保留了这一信息,可以通过助记词恢复钱包及其资产。这种方式可以规避私钥丢失所带来的损失。 2. **账户找回服务**:部分钱包提供找回账户的服务,用户可以通过身份验证找回自己的资产。但这种服务一般都伴随着风险,因为必须提供许多个人信息。 3. **寻求专业帮助**:虽然不建议寻找黑客帮助,但一些区块链专家可能会提供合法地找回丢失资产的帮助。但是,需确保选择的专业人士是经过信任和验证的。 4. **预防胜于治疗**:失去私钥后,最重要的教训便是备份和管理私钥。在创建钱包的同时,务必进行助记词和私钥的备份,将其存在安全的地方。 #### 小结总的来说,Imtoken钱包的私钥长度通常为66个字符长(一个前缀和64个十六进制数字)。管理和保护私钥是确保用户资产安全的关键。在使用区块链技术时,用户需要充分意识到私钥的重要性和潜在风险,并采取必要的措施加以预防和保护。
这些措施不仅包含安全的存储方式和管理实践,还包括对可能发生的问题和危机的预判和准备。只有这样,用户才能在这个不断演变的区块链世界中,保障自己的资产安全。
leave a reply